Transaction 8ff35e04c98b60bd1150875c8ecfd7062c7288eb8bf91b4703b23abafe10a154
1 Input
1 Output
-
8ff35e04c98b60bd1150875c8ecfd7062c7288eb8bf91b4703b23abafe10a154:0
- value
- 29594
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ddbc556337580a0547e407fa01ddb9619fe1850b6a76cbc2a843d8bb21750020
- address
- bc1pmk792cehtq9q23lyqlaqrhdevx07rpgtdfmvhs4gg0vtkgt4qqsqdh47mz